Your innkeepers will help identify special pet activities & services including hiking trails, pet friendly parks, pet specialty stores plus local veterinary & grooming services for a pet spa day.
Hiking trails - Dogs and their humans enjoy a
huge number of hiking options.
The Rattlesnake trailhead - 15 minutes away - offers a series of dog friendly trails and easy climbs.
Franconia Notch State Park - 25 minutes drive - has over a dozen dog friendly trails. The only trail, which isn't dog friendly, is the Flume Gorge.
Greeley Ponds and the Lincoln Woods Wilderness Trail - 25 minutes drive - off the Kancamagus Highway scenic Byway - offers several moderate dog friendly hiking options
The Welch-Dickey Loop Trail - 25 minutes - off Upper Mad River Road in Waterville Valley - provides another terrific hike for humans and their favorite four-legged friends.
Boating
You can take your best four-legged friend on a six or ten mile paddle on the "Pemi" River. Canoes provide a great home for floating dogs. The river scenery is spectacular.
Take your dog on a cruise around Squam Lake. Rent small aluminum runabouts or roomy, comfortable pontoon boats.

Our PET POLICY is designed for everyone's convenience and protection. We welcome well-behaved dogs but do so with the following expectations. No more than 2 dogs per room. Pets may be left in guest rooms without 'their' humans during meals and for longer periods - if crated - subject to prior agreement with the innkeepers. Dogs are not permitted in public areas and must be on a leash when on the property.
